Abstract

The utility model discloses a storage cabinet, which relates to the technical field of furniture design and comprises an adjusting plate, wherein a height adjusting assembly is arranged at the bottom of the adjusting plate and used for adjusting the height of the storage cabinet, a folding mechanism is arranged at the top of the adjusting plate and comprises two first folding plates, two second folding plates and a top plate. According to the utility model, the clamping assembly, the rear cover, the first folding plate and the second folding plate are arranged, the top plate can be moved upwards, the first folding plate and the second folding plate are pulled up until the first folding plate and the second folding plate are completely straightened, the compression spring in the clamping assembly generates counter force and is applied to the top of the clamping plate, the clamping plate enters the inner wall of the clamping groove, the first folding plate and the second folding plate are mutually fixedly supported in a clamping mode, the rear cover falls off due to gravity at the moment, the rear part is sealed, and the storage cabinet can be opened at the moment.

As a preferred embodiment of the embodiment, the height adjusting assembly comprises two moving blocks and a threaded rod 11, two ends of the threaded rod 11 are rotatably installed at two sides of the inner wall of the adjusting plate 1, a first threaded hole and a second threaded hole are formed in the middle of the outer wall of one side of the two moving blocks opposite to each other, two ends of the threaded rod 11 are in threaded connection with the inner wall of the first threaded hole and the inner wall of the second threaded hole, the inner wall of the first threaded hole and the inner wall of the second threaded hole are opposite to the connecting threads of the threaded rod 11, one end of a connecting rod 16 is rotatably installed at two sides of the moving blocks, a bottom plate 8 is arranged at the bottom of the adjusting plate 1, the other end of the connecting rod 16 is rotatably installed on one side of the inner wall of the bottom plate 8, a handle 7 is installed at one side of the threaded rod 11, the handle 7 rotates the threaded rod 11, because the inner walls of the first threaded hole and the inner wall of the second threaded hole are opposite to the connecting threads of the threaded rod 11, the threaded rod 11 is just reversing and can make two movable blocks keep away from each other or be close to each other, keeps away from each other when two movable blocks, can make the angle grow between connecting rod 16 and the bottom plate 8, carries out the locker and carries out height control this moment.
In this embodiment, the guiding hole has been seted up on one side of movable block outer wall, and the inner wall slidable mounting of guiding hole has guide bar 10, and the both ends of guide bar 10 are installed in the both sides of adjusting plate 1 inner wall, and guide bar 10 and threaded rod 11 mutually support, can guarantee that the movable block keeps horizontal migration at the 11 pivoted condition of threaded rod.
As a preferred embodiment of this embodiment, the joint subassembly includes joint board 12, the rectangular channel has been seted up to one side outer wall of second folded sheet 4, the spout has all been seted up on the both sides of rectangular channel inner wall, the slider is all installed on the both sides of joint board 12, slider slidable mounting is on the inner wall of spout, the joint groove has been seted up at the top of first folded sheet 5, joint board 12 and joint groove looks adaptation, the top of joint board 12 is provided with compresses tightly the subassembly, first folded sheet 5 and second folded sheet 4 are straightened completely, joint board 12 gets into the inner wall in joint groove, make first folded sheet 5 and second folded sheet 4 can not fifty percent discount each other, fold.
In this embodiment, the pressure components includes dead lever 13, dead lever 13 is installed at the top of rectangular channel inner wall, the slip hole has been seted up at the top of joint board 12, dead lever 13 slidable mounting is on the inner wall in slip hole, dead lever 13 cup joints and installs pressure spring, pressure spring's both ends contact with the top and the joint board 12 of rectangular channel inner wall respectively, pressure spring produces the counter force, apply the top at joint board 12, make joint board 12 be difficult to deviate from the joint groove, increase folding stability, dead lever 13 sets up simultaneously, can joint board 12 be rectilinear movement.
As a preferred implementation mode of the embodiment, universal wheels 9 are mounted at four corners of the bottom of the adjusting plate 1, and the universal wheels 9 roll instead of slide, so that the whole storage cabinet can be conveniently moved.
As a preferred embodiment of this embodiment, a sliding cavity is opened on one side outer wall of the top plate 3, sliding grooves 14 are opened on both sides inner walls of the sliding cavity, a cover plate 2 is slidably installed on the inner wall of the sliding cavity, pulleys 17 are rotatably installed on both sides of the outer wall of the cover plate 2 at the top end position, the pulleys 17 are slidably installed inside the sliding grooves 14, a pull groove 6 is opened on one side outer wall of the cover plate 2, the pulleys 17 roll instead of slide, friction damage can be reduced, the cover plate 2 can be conveniently stored due to the arrangement of the sliding cavity, that is, the cover plate 2 is stored into the sliding cavity.
